Wavestream BUC POB-KAN120-HW2
The Wavestream BUC POB-KAN120-HW24 connector can be used to monitor the following information via SNMP:
- Heartbeat control
- Status and fault information, statistics, and inventory management
- Alarms
- Mode and state control
- Power control
- Warning, non-latching, and latching fault thresholds

Configuration
Connections
This connector uses two Simple Network Management Protocol (SNMPv3) connections, one for SNMP GET and SET operations and one for traps.
SNMP Connection - Main
This SNMP connection is used for traps.
SNMP CONNECTION:
- IP address/host: The polling IP of the device. e.g., 10.11.12.123.
- Port: 162.
SNMP Connection - Device
This connection is used to poll device parameters.
SNMP CONNECTION - DEVICE:
- IP address/host: The polling IP of the device. e.g., 10.11.12.123.
- Port: 161.
NOTE: For the connector to be able to poll information from the device, you will also need to fill in the security level and protocol, user name, authentication password and algorithm, and encryption password and algorithm in the More SNMP Settings section during element creation.

How to use
The element displays information about the Wavestream BUC equipment such as inventory data, equipment status information, sensors data, configuration information, trap thresholds, and the history of the received traps.
On the Configuration, Stream Control, NTP & Trap Configuration, and Traps Thresholds pages, you can configure parameters to set up the device.
To activate alarm monitoring and trending, you will need to create and assign and alarm and trend templates.
